From 667e6e388e39b8b5f315dfae46d40fe8f1ce5195 Mon Sep 17 00:00:00 2001 From: Keyvan Ebrahimpour Date: Wed, 9 Apr 2025 22:48:11 +0000 Subject: [PATCH] Initial commit: static site + Dockerfile --- Dockerfile | 2 ++ index.html | 12 ++++++++++++ script.js | 7 +++++++ style.css | 22 ++++++++++++++++++++++ 4 files changed, 43 insertions(+) create mode 100644 Dockerfile create mode 100644 index.html create mode 100644 script.js create mode 100644 style.css diff --git a/Dockerfile b/Dockerfile new file mode 100644 index 0000000..6e8acef --- /dev/null +++ b/Dockerfile @@ -0,0 +1,2 @@ +FROM nginx:alpine +COPY . /usr/share/nginx/html diff --git a/index.html b/index.html new file mode 100644 index 0000000..b7fc8f4 --- /dev/null +++ b/index.html @@ -0,0 +1,12 @@ + + + + + Avisenna Engineering + + + +

🚧 This site is under construction. Stay tuned!

+ + + diff --git a/script.js b/script.js new file mode 100644 index 0000000..a05c770 --- /dev/null +++ b/script.js @@ -0,0 +1,7 @@ +console.log("Avisenna Engineering landing page loaded!"); + +window.addEventListener('DOMContentLoaded', () => { + const message = document.createElement('p'); + message.innerText = "We’re glad you’re here."; + document.body.appendChild(message); +}); diff --git a/style.css b/style.css new file mode 100644 index 0000000..d7ccc24 --- /dev/null +++ b/style.css @@ -0,0 +1,22 @@ +body { + background-color: #0f172a; + color: #facc15; + font-family: 'Segoe UI', Tahoma, Geneva, Verdana, sans-serif; + margin: 0; + padding: 0; + display: flex; + height: 100vh; + justify-content: center; + align-items: center; + text-align: center; + flex-direction: column; +} + +h1 { + font-size: 2.5rem; + margin-bottom: 1rem; +} + +p { + font-size: 1.25rem; +}